2011 RSD to ARS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the RSD to ARS ex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 5, valuing the pair at 0.0614.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 10, dropping to 0.0484.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0130 ARS.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0507 to the December average rate of 0.0549, the exchange rate registered a net change of 8.11%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 0.0614 was up 7.68% compared to the 2010 peak of 0.0570,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0527 0.0484 0.0507
February 0.0540 0.0527 0.0532
March 0.0560 0.0535 0.0548
April 0.0610 0.0558 0.0581
May 0.0614 0.0580 0.0598
June 0.0613 0.0574 0.0593
July 0.0595 0.0562 0.0577
August 0.0600 0.0572 0.0585
September 0.0599 0.0554 0.0575
October 0.0601 0.0548 0.0577
November 0.0581 0.0550 0.0564
December 0.0559 0.0526 0.0549
